Architecting a vCloud Availability for vCloud Director Solution : Use Cases
   
Use Cases
The vCloud Availability for vCloud Director solution enables usage of a public vCloud Director endpoint as a target for vSphere Replication. vSphere Replication is provided by the hypervisor and supports essentially any virtualized workload without any dependence on application or operating system disaster recovery (DR) capability. vSphere 5.5, 6.0 and 6.5 environments are supported, while only vSphere 6.x provides replication in both directions (to and from the cloud). Only running virtual machines are replicated which means templates or powered-off VMs cannot be protected and must be replicated with a different solution (for example, VMware vCloud Connector® or VMware vCenter® Content Library synchronization).
While the main use case is disaster recovery, the solution can be also leveraged for migration services where minimal workload downtime is required.
